Condition Update

Ended up not summiting due to a combination of starting a little late, iffy weather and feeling a little light headed that slowed me down, but thought I'd go ahead and leave conditions report for as far as I got. Was planning on doing the 3 combo but didn't work out for today. The previous reports weren't joking about the water on the trail/road. Huge sections that are like ponds, some with rocks you can hop across but others don't. But almost all of them had little trails that went off to the right to get around them. Didn't encounter any snow but Lincoln and some others from the drive up had some fresh snow on them. I got to the lake and decided I wasn't going to summit but kept going to see how far I could get, and got to a flat marshy area above the waterfalls. The trail to that point was a little hard to find, also I'd avoid going along the lake edge cause multiple times my boots got soaked and covered in mud from what looked like solid ground but wasn't lol. There's a trail that starts where the road ends that takes you to the area to ascend that I missed since I went right to the lake first. Whole bunch of mine shafts up there too and lots of debris with nails sticking up to watch out for. Also the point I stopped at said 4.24 miles but I still had a good 1400+ft gain at least so idk if that all happens in the last .25 miles or if its longer than 9 RT.
